Peter R. Foster is a scholar working on Molecular Biology, Cardiology and Cardiovascular Medicine and Hematology. According to data from OpenAlex, Peter R. Foster has authored 44 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Molecular Biology, 12 papers in Cardiology and Cardiovascular Medicine and 10 papers in Hematology. Recurrent topics in Peter R. Foster’s work include Hemophilia Treatment and Research (9 papers), Protein purification and stability (7 papers) and Cardiac electrophysiology and arrhythmias (7 papers). Peter R. Foster is often cited by papers focused on Hemophilia Treatment and Research (9 papers), Protein purification and stability (7 papers) and Cardiac electrophysiology and arrhythmias (7 papers). Peter R. Foster collaborates with scholars based in United Kingdom, United States and Portugal. Peter R. Foster's co-authors include Douglas P. Zipes, Paul J. Troup, Enhong Cao, Zhanfeng Cui, Victor Elharrar, Winston E. Gaum, P. Dunnill, M. D. Lilly, B. Griffin and Shirley L. MacDonald and has published in prestigious journals such as Circulation, Journal of the American College of Cardiology and Circulation Research.
